Best T-shirts for Layering Under Jackets


Layering starts with the piece closest to the body. A jacket can create the outer shape, but the T-shirt underneath decides the balance. It affects the neckline, proportion, colour story and overall mood of the outfit.

The best T-shirts for layering are not always the loudest. They are the ones that sit cleanly, hold their shape and add just enough presence beneath outerwear.

Choose the right neckline

A clean neckline makes layering feel sharper. The collar should sit flat and remain visible without fighting the jacket.

Crew neck T-shirts are the most versatile because they work under denim jackets, bombers, overshirts, leather jackets and tailored outerwear.

If the jacket has a strong collar or lapel, a simple crew neck keeps the outfit grounded.

Keep the shoulder line considered

The shoulder of the T-shirt affects how the jacket sits. A regular-fit tee usually layers neatly under structured jackets. A loose fit tee gives more ease under relaxed outerwear.

Oversized tees can work, but they need a jacket with enough room to avoid bunching.

The aim is comfort without bulk.

Think about fabric weight

Lightweight T-shirts are easy to wear under slimmer jackets, but they can sometimes lose their shape. Heavyweight T-shirts give more structure and can make the outfit feel more premium, especially when the jacket is worn open.

For everyday layering, a midweight or heavyweight cotton tee often gives the best balance between comfort, shape and durability.

Use colour to connect the look

A black T-shirt under a black jacket creates a clean, uninterrupted line. A white T-shirt under a dark jacket brings contrast and clarity.

Grey, cream, washed tones and muted colours can soften the outfit.

If the jacket is the statement, keep the T-shirt simple. If the T-shirt carries a graphic, choose a jacket that frames it rather than covers it.

Let graphics sit with intention

Graphic T-shirts can work beautifully under jackets when the placement is visible. A centre chest graphic, small emblem, or text detail can create focus without overwhelming the look.

The key is spacing. The graphic should not feel trapped under the jacket. It should appear deliberate, like part of the composition.

Check the length

The T-shirt hem should work with the jacket length. A tee that is slightly longer than the jacket can add a relaxed streetwear feel. A tee that sits in line with the jacket creates a cleaner silhouette.

Neither is wrong. The choice depends on the mood.

The best layering T-shirts are clean in fit, strong in fabric and intentional in detail. They do not disappear under the jacket. They complete it.
